Sailors at Buckenham started the Club House Trophy Race in a light breeze. However the wind picked up and led to some exciting sailing.
Javelin Big Zipper went well ahead of the fleet on three sail spinnaker reaches, closely followed by Jim Frost in Phantom Skylark. Despite capsizing, Pete Lumley in Laser Yare Baby finished third. These three finished in that order and kept their places on corrected time. There were a number of retirements further down the fleet.
In the General Allcomers race, Big Zipper got 'unzipped' when their spinnaker went under the hull and Jim Frost in Skylark and Pete Lumley finished well ahead of the Javelin to take first and second respectively.
In the Junior race, Joseph Burrell in Eclipse was the only competitor to finish the course.
